0.25-0.50....Top two pair on a flush-flop
 
0.25-0.50 full ring

no reads

Preflop:
UTG limps, couple of limpers, I limp J [img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img] T [img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img] on the BTN, call check.

Flop 8 [img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] T [img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] J [img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img]:
SB checks, BB bets, UTG raises, folds, I 3bet with my JT?, SB calls, BB calls, UTG calls.

Turn 4 [img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img]:
SB and BB checks, UTG donks, I?

Blzdwrath 11-24-2007 02:41 PM

Re: 0.25-0.50....Top two pair on a flush-flop
 
I would not raise this turn. Reason being is I don't think you make enough money by charging the people with a single diamond to compensate for the likely chance (with so many callers) that someone has already made their flush. Not to mention someone may (although more unlikely than the flush) already have a straight also. I would just call the turn and hope you dodge a Q, 9, or diamond; or better yet hit one of your four outs for a full house.
